Predictive analytics on COVID-19 data using Hive based on Hadoop cluster

Ali Abbood Khaleel,
Ali Noori Kareem,
Laith Hikmet Mahdi

Abstract: COVID-19 pandemic has received a serious attention from academia, industry and governments to stop the huge number of deaths and economic disruptions around the world. Many techniques have been used to control the spread of the pandemic by understanding its characteristics and behavior. However, because of the large amounts and complex characteristics of COVID-19 data, the querying and analysis of such data using conventional tools have become a challenging task. “…Khaleel et al [8] explores the utilization of Hive on a Hadoop cluster for querying and analyzing COVID-19 datasets, presenting a comparative analysis with traditional relational database management system (RDBMS). Various Hive properties and parameters, including compression, MapReduce strict mode, parallel reduce tasks, cost-based optimization, and optimized record columnar, were fine-tuned to enhance the proposed approach.…”
